| The Man from Nevada(1929) United States of America
 B&W : Five reels / 4758 reels
 Directed by J.P. McGowan
 Cast: Tom Tyler [Jack Carter], Natalie Joyce [Virginia Watkins], Al Ferguson [Luke Baldrige], Bill Nolte (William L. Nolte) [‘Bowery’ Walker], Al Heuston [Jim Watkins], Kip Cooper [‘Wart’ Watkins], Godfrey Craig [‘Wiggles’ Watkins], Frank Crane [‘Wobbles’ Watkins], [?] ? [James Baldrige, the land office manager], [?] ? [the sheriff] J.P. McGowan Productions production; distributed on State Rights basis by Syndicate Pictures Corporation [?] and/or Bell Pictures, Incorporated? [Syndicate Pictures]. / Produced by J.P. McGowan. Scenario by Sally Winters, from a screen story by Sally Winters. Technical direction by James Casey. Photography (cinematography) by Hap Depew. Presented by Syndicate Pictures Corporation. / Released August 1929. / Standard 35mm spherical 1.33:1 format. / Despite attributions by Website-AFI and Website-IMDb, toddler Frank Crane is not the same as Frank Hall Crane. / Silent film. Drama: Western. Survival status: Print exists in the UCLA Film and Television Archive film archive (Dino Everett collection) [35mm nitrate positive]. Current rights holder: Public domain [USA].
